加速度计时间序列数据分析可以通过数据预处理、特征提取、模型训练、结果评估等步骤进行。 数据预处理是整个分析过程的基础,包括数据清洗、降噪、归一化等步骤。数据清洗可以去除无效数据和异常值,从而提高数据的质量和可靠性。降噪可以通过滤波器等技术减少数据中的噪声,提升数据的平滑性和准确性。归一化可以使数据在相同尺度上进行比较,从而提高模型的性能。特征提取是从时间序列数据中提取有用的信息,可以使用统计特征、频域特征、时频特征等。模型训练是根据特征选择合适的算法进行建模,比如机器学习算法、深度学习算法等。结果评估是通过准确率、召回率、F1分数等指标对模型进行评价,以确保模型的有效性和可靠性。
一、数据预处理
数据预处理是加速度计时间序列数据分析的第一步,包含数据清洗、降噪、归一化等步骤。数据清洗可以通过去除无效数据和异常值来提高数据的质量和可靠性。无效数据可能包括缺失值、重复数据等,异常值可能包括超出合理范围的数据点。降噪可以通过滤波器等技术减少数据中的噪声,提升数据的平滑性和准确性。常用的滤波器包括低通滤波器、高通滤波器、带通滤波器等。归一化可以使数据在相同尺度上进行比较,从而提高模型的性能。常见的归一化方法包括最小-最大归一化、Z-score归一化等。
二、特征提取
特征提取是从时间序列数据中提取有用的信息,常用的方法包括统计特征、频域特征、时频特征等。统计特征包括均值、方差、标准差、峰度、偏度等,可以反映数据的整体分布情况。频域特征包括傅里叶变换、功率谱密度等,可以反映数据在频域上的特性。时频特征包括小波变换、短时傅里叶变换等,可以同时反映数据在时域和频域上的特性。不同的特征可以捕捉数据的不同方面的信息,从而提高模型的性能。
三、模型训练
模型训练是根据提取的特征选择合适的算法进行建模,常用的算法包括机器学习算法、深度学习算法等。机器学习算法包括决策树、随机森林、支持向量机、K近邻等,可以处理不同类型的数据和任务。深度学习算法包括卷积神经网络、循环神经网络、长短时记忆网络等,可以处理复杂的时序数据和高维数据。选择合适的算法需要根据具体的任务和数据特点进行选择,并通过交叉验证等方法进行模型调优。
四、结果评估
结果评估是通过准确率、召回率、F1分数等指标对模型进行评价,以确保模型的有效性和可靠性。准确率是指模型预测正确的比例,召回率是指模型正确识别出所有正例的比例,F1分数是准确率和召回率的调和平均。除了这些基本指标外,还可以通过混淆矩阵、ROC曲线、AUC值等指标进行更细致的评估。通过多种指标的综合评估,可以全面了解模型的性能和不足,从而进行相应的改进和优化。
FineBI是一款由帆软推出的商业智能(BI)工具,可以帮助用户进行数据分析、数据可视化等工作。FineBI官网: https://s.fanruan.com/f459r;。在进行加速度计时间序列数据分析时,FineBI可以通过其强大的数据处理和可视化功能,帮助用户快速、准确地进行数据分析和结果展示。通过FineBI,用户可以轻松地进行数据预处理、特征提取、模型训练和结果评估,从而提高数据分析的效率和效果。
数据预处理可以通过FineBI的多种数据清洗和降噪工具来实现。FineBI提供了丰富的数据预处理功能,包括数据清洗、降噪、归一化等,可以帮助用户快速、高效地进行数据预处理。通过FineBI,用户可以轻松地去除无效数据和异常值,减少数据中的噪声,提高数据的质量和可靠性。
特征提取可以通过FineBI的多种特征提取工具来实现。FineBI提供了丰富的特征提取功能,包括统计特征、频域特征、时频特征等,可以帮助用户快速、准确地提取有用的信息。通过FineBI,用户可以轻松地提取均值、方差、标准差、峰度、偏度等统计特征,进行傅里叶变换、功率谱密度等频域分析,进行小波变换、短时傅里叶变换等时频分析,从而提高数据分析的效果。
模型训练可以通过FineBI的多种模型训练工具来实现。FineBI提供了丰富的模型训练功能,包括决策树、随机森林、支持向量机、K近邻等机器学习算法,卷积神经网络、循环神经网络、长短时记忆网络等深度学习算法,可以帮助用户快速、高效地进行模型训练。通过FineBI,用户可以轻松地选择合适的算法进行建模,并通过交叉验证等方法进行模型调优,从而提高模型的性能。
结果评估可以通过FineBI的多种结果评估工具来实现。FineBI提供了丰富的结果评估功能,包括准确率、召回率、F1分数等基本指标,混淆矩阵、ROC曲线、AUC值等高级指标,可以帮助用户全面、准确地评估模型的性能。通过FineBI,用户可以轻松地进行多种指标的综合评估,全面了解模型的性能和不足,从而进行相应的改进和优化。
通过FineBI,用户可以轻松地进行加速度计时间序列数据分析,从数据预处理、特征提取、模型训练到结果评估,FineBI提供了一整套完善的解决方案,帮助用户快速、高效地进行数据分析和结果展示。F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
加速度计时间序列数据分析怎么做
加速度计是一种用于测量加速度的传感器,广泛应用于运动监测、健康管理、物体运动分析等领域。对加速度计时间序列数据的分析可以揭示出很多有价值的信息,包括运动模式、活动分类和异常检测等。本文将详细探讨如何进行加速度计时间序列数据分析,涵盖数据预处理、特征提取、数据建模和可视化等多个方面。
加速度计时间序列数据分析的基本步骤是什么?
加速度计数据分析的基本步骤包括数据采集、数据预处理、特征提取、建模与分析、以及结果可视化。
-
数据采集:使用加速度计设备(如手机、穿戴设备等)进行运动数据的采集。确保采集设备的准确性和稳定性,记录下足够的时间序列数据。
-
数据预处理:对原始数据进行清理和标准化,处理缺失值和噪声。这一阶段可能包括对数据进行滤波、去除异常值、归一化等操作,以确保数据的质量。
-
特征提取:从预处理后的数据中提取出有意义的特征。这些特征可以是时域特征(如均值、标准差、最大值等)和频域特征(如频谱分析结果),有助于后续的分析和建模。
-
建模与分析:选择合适的分析模型,如机器学习模型(决策树、支持向量机、神经网络等)或统计模型,进行分类、回归或聚类分析。
-
结果可视化:通过图表和可视化工具展示分析结果,使结果更加直观易懂。这可以包括时间序列图、特征分布图、混淆矩阵等。
在进行加速度计数据分析时,如何进行数据预处理?
数据预处理是确保数据分析成功的关键步骤,以下是一些常见的预处理方法。
-
数据清理:检查并处理缺失值。可以用均值、中位数或其他方法填充缺失值,或者直接删除含有缺失值的样本。
-
去噪声:原始数据中可能会有各种噪声,例如环境干扰或传感器误差。可以使用低通滤波器、高通滤波器或卡尔曼滤波器等方法进行去噪。
-
归一化:为了消除不同量纲和尺度对模型的影响,通常需要对数据进行归一化处理。常见的方法有最小-最大缩放和Z-score标准化。
-
分段处理:对于长时间的加速度计数据,可以将数据分成多个段,以便于分析不同时间窗口内的运动特征。
-
特征选择:在提取特征之前,进行特征选择可以帮助减少计算量,提升模型性能。可以使用相关性分析、逐步回归等方法进行特征选择。
特征提取在加速度计数据分析中有哪些常用的方法?
特征提取是从时间序列数据中提取出有用信息的过程,以下是一些常用的方法。
-
时域特征:包括均值、方差、最大值、最小值、峰度和偏度等。这些特征能够反映信号的基本统计特性。
-
频域特征:通过傅里叶变换等方法,将时域信号转换为频域信号,提取出频谱特征,如主频、频带能量等。
-
时间-频率特征:使用小波变换等方法分析信号的时间-频率特性,能够捕捉到信号在不同时间和频率下的变化。
-
自相关和互相关:通过计算自相关和互相关,可以分析信号的周期性和相关性,这对运动模式识别有重要意义。
-
信号包络:分析信号的包络线,能够提取出信号的主要变化趋势,适用于动态特征的提取。
在加速度计数据分析中,常用的建模方法有哪些?
建模是加速度计数据分析的核心环节,选择合适的模型能够提升分析效果。以下是一些常用的建模方法。
-
线性回归:适用于简单的线性关系建模,可以有效识别加速度与其他变量之间的线性关系。
-
决策树:通过建立树状结构进行分类或回归,简单易懂且具有较好的解释性。
-
随机森林:基于多棵决策树的集成学习方法,能够提高模型的准确性和鲁棒性。
-
支持向量机(SVM):适用于高维空间的分类问题,能够有效处理非线性问题。
-
神经网络:深度学习方法,能够提取复杂特征,适合大规模数据的分析。
-
K-means聚类:用于无监督学习,能够将数据分为不同的簇,以便于识别相似的运动模式。
如何对加速度计数据分析的结果进行可视化?
可视化是数据分析中不可或缺的一部分,能够帮助更好地理解分析结果。以下是一些有效的可视化方法。
-
时间序列图:通过绘制加速度随时间变化的曲线,直观展示运动的动态特征。
-
散点图:可用于展示不同特征之间的关系,帮助识别数据中的模式和异常点。
-
箱线图:展示特征的分布情况,包括中位数、四分位数和异常值,适合用于比较不同类之间的差异。
-
热力图:通过颜色深浅展示特征之间的相关性,便于识别高相关特征。
-
混淆矩阵:在分类问题中,可视化模型的分类结果,帮助分析模型的准确性和错误类型。
在加速度计时间序列数据分析中,如何评估模型的性能?
评估模型性能是确保分析结果可信的关键步骤。以下是一些常用的评估指标。
-
准确率(Accuracy):分类模型的正确预测比例,适合于类别分布均衡的数据集。
-
精确率(Precision):在所有预测为正的样本中,实际为正的比例,适合于关注假阳性较少的场景。
-
召回率(Recall):在所有实际为正的样本中,预测为正的比例,适合于关注假阴性较少的场景。
-
F1-score:精确率和召回率的调和平均数,综合考虑了精确率与召回率的平衡。
-
ROC曲线和AUC值:通过绘制接收者操作特征曲线,评估模型在不同阈值下的表现,AUC值越接近1,模型性能越好。
总结
对加速度计时间序列数据的分析是一个系统性工程,涵盖了数据采集、预处理、特征提取、建模与分析、可视化等多个环节。通过合理的步骤和方法,能够深入挖掘数据背后的信息,为运动监测、健康管理等领域提供有力支持。随着技术的不断进步,未来在加速度计数据分析中,机器学习和深度学习等先进技术将会发挥越来越重要的作用。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。